3. Products, pricing and availability

All prices are shown in South African Rand and include VAT where VAT applies. Delivery charges are calculated and shown separately at checkout before you pay.

Product images, descriptions and specifications are supplied to us by manufacturers and distributors. We make every effort to describe products accurately, but images are illustrative and packaging, bundled accessories and minor specifications can change without notice.

Stock availability reflects our suppliers' reported stock and can change between the moment you add an item to your cart and the moment you pay. If an item turns out to be unavailable after you have paid, we will contact you and offer a replacement, a delayed delivery, or a full refund of that item.

We take reasonable care to price our products correctly, but obvious errors happen. Where a price is clearly wrong — for example an item listed at a small fraction of its market value — we may cancel the affected order and refund you in full rather than fulfil it, in line with section 23 of the Consumer Protection Act.

4. Orders and when a contract is formed

Placing an order is an offer to buy. Your order is only accepted, and a sale concluded, once we have received your payment and sent you an order confirmation. Adding an item to your cart or reaching the payment page does not conclude a sale.

While your payment is pending we reserve the stock for your order. If payment is not completed, the reservation is released and the items return to general availability.

We may decline or cancel an order where the item is unavailable, where the price or description was clearly incorrect, where we suspect fraud, or where we cannot deliver to the address given. If we cancel an order you have paid for, we refund you in full.

5. Payment

Payment is taken through our payment provider's secure checkout. We do not receive or store your card number, CVV or banking credentials. Your order is confirmed once the provider has confirmed the payment to us.

Ownership of the goods passes to you once we have received payment in full. Risk in the goods passes to you on delivery.

6. Delivery

We deliver within South Africa. Delivery charges and estimated timeframes are calculated at checkout based on your delivery address and the items in your order.

Delivery timeframes are estimates given in good faith and are not guaranteed. They depend on supplier dispatch and on our courier partners, and can be affected by events outside our control. Where a delivery is going to be materially late, we will contact you.

Somebody must be available to receive and sign for the parcel at the address you gave us. If delivery fails because nobody was available or the address was wrong, further delivery attempts may be charged for. Please check your parcel on delivery and tell us immediately if it arrives damaged — see our Returns and Refunds Policy.
